i had this problem too. Yes, they are subs and only play low frequencies. That's why you don't hear much. If you hear nothing at all they are likely blown. You should go with a 2 ohm speaker to get the best sound. I went and bought 2 JL Audio 6.5" subs for there and at 4 ohms they don't sound no where as good as the stockers at 2-ohms. The monsoon amp doesn't push them enough to outplay the other speakers at 2 ohms. If you put a 4 ohm speakers in you're only getting half of the required power to the speaker coil and it won't produce as much. I'm kinda new to this too. have i got a wealth of info on this, i have been thru all of this with the monsoon, an d learned a lot the hard way, but the facts are right off a gm wiring schematic, the 6.5" in the door are midranges rated at 2 ohms, then there is a tweeter in each door rated at 4 ohms, the ones by the back seat are 4 ohm subs, the 4" in back are 4 ohm midranges then there are a pair of 4 ohm tweeters way in back, and it sounds really bad when 4 ohm speakers are put in place of 2 ohm speakers. i have yet to find aftermarket 2 ohm speakers, if anyone has LET ME KNOW. right now i am bsck to all stock except i replace the 4" mids with normal 2 way speakers, if i could get 2 ohms speaks for the doors i would be a happy man. but the proper way to do it would be to repace the midranges with midranges at the right ohm rating, and the tweeters, and subs, but that could become quite expensive and impossible being that i have not found 2 ohm speakers, and even though car acceseries shops claim 4 ohm speaks will work, they will not.
